Abstract

An end closure for a container having a substantially planar first lid portion including an engaging element for engaging an upper rim of a container to be closed, a second substantially planar lid portion rotatably mounted to an upper surface of the first lid portion, the second lid portion having an opening defined therethrough, and an openable lid portion defined in the first lid portion. The openable lid portion includes a flexible hinge extending along first and second edge portions thereof and a frangible coupling extending along the remaining edges thereof including an edge segment which extends between and interconnects the first and second edge portions of the flexible hinge. A bottom surface of the first lid portion includes an engaging member for engaging an inner free edge of the openable lid portion defined by the frangible edge segment, so that when force is applied to the openable lid portion the frangible coupling is broken and the openable lid portion pivots about said first and second edge portions, the inner free edge engages the engaging member so as to retain said openable lid portion in an open disposition.
